概括
与银行业务和借贷相关的可交易许可证系统 (TLS) 无论最初的许可证分配情况如何,都能达到最佳的结果. 灵活的机制可以提高环境和资源管理的效率.

背景情况:
- 可交易许可系统 (TLS) 是环境和资源管理的关键政策工具.
- 公司的目标是通过最佳的许可使用和交易来最大限度地提高折扣净收益.
研究的目的:
- 用时间灵活的数量机制分析一般TLS的动态效率和价格行为.
- 在多期动态模型中比较固定数量,仅银行和银行和借贷机制.
主要方法:
- 为TLS构建一个多周期动态模型.
- 分析公司行为优化贴现净收益.
- 在不同的机制下检查去中心化的平衡和价格动态.
主要成果:
- 固定数量的TLS需要高效的初始分配,以获得最佳的收益.
- 仅为银行服务的TLS在累计初始分配达到一个值时实现最佳效益,Hotelling-rule价格动态.
- 银行和借款TLS始终实现最佳结果和Hotelling规则价格动态,无论最初的分配.
结论:
- 时间灵活的数量机制显著影响TLS效率.
- 初始许可分配和灵活机制之间的协同效应对于最佳的TLS设计至关重要.
- 银行和借贷提供了最强大的方法,以最大限度地发挥动态TLS的好处.
